Load Leg Strength

Choosing a convertible car seat with a load leg hinges on understanding its strength, which directly impacts safety. The load leg’s primary role is to absorb and distribute crash forces, keeping the seat stable during a collision. Its strength depends on the quality of materials and construction; steel-reinforced legs provide superior durability and crash resistance. A strong load leg minimizes rotational movement, offering better protection for your child. It’s essential that the load leg is securely anchored to the vehicle floor to maximize stability during sudden stops or impacts. Regularly inspecting the attachment points and material integrity ensures consistent safety performance over time. Ultimately, a robust load leg considerably enhances the overall safety and stability of the car seat, giving you peace of mind on every trip.

Safety Certification Standards

As safety certification standards evolve, it’s essential to ascertain that convertible car seats with load legs meet or surpass these benchmarks to guarantee maximum protection. Federal standards like FMVSS 213 set strict requirements for crashworthiness, ensuring seats can withstand impact forces. Many seats are tested for structural integrity, rollover resistance, and temperature resilience, demonstrating their durability and safety. Upcoming regulations, such as the 2025 side impact standards, demand enhanced protection, especially for side impacts. Manufacturers must provide thorough crash testing results and certification labels verifying compliance with these standards. Certification confirms that the seat has undergone rigorous evaluation and meets safety benchmarks, giving you peace of mind that your child’s seat offers ideal protection during travel.

Space-Saving Design

Maximizing backseat space is essential when selecting a convertible car seat with a load leg, especially if you need to fit multiple seats across in your vehicle. Space-saving designs typically feature slim profiles, around 16.9 inches wide or less, helping you optimize interior capacity. These seats often incorporate load legs that provide stability without requiring extra space for bulky base extensions. Many models offer adjustable or foldable load legs, which can be customized to fit different vehicle floor heights, further enhancing space efficiency. This clever design allows parents to install multiple car seats side by side while maintaining comfort and safety. By choosing a seat with a space-saving profile, you can make the most of your backseat and ensure everyone has enough room.

Installation Ease

Choosing a convertible car seat with a load leg becomes easier when you consider how simple it is to install. Many models have a tensioning or locking mechanism that secures the load leg firmly without extra tools, streamlining the setup process. Clear, step-by-step instructions or level indicators help guarantee you attach the load leg correctly, reducing guesswork. The adjustable length of the load leg makes fitting it into different vehicle floors straightforward, accommodating various car heights. Some seats even feature click-in or lock-in mechanisms that produce an audible click, confirming proper engagement. These features not only make installation quicker but also more reliable, giving me confidence that the seat is correctly secured for safe travel.

Are Load Legs Compatible With All Vehicle Types?

Load legs aren’t compatible with all vehicle types. For example, in smaller cars or those with low seats, installing a load leg can be tricky or impossible. I’ve seen parents struggle fitting seats with load legs in compact models. Before buying, I recommend checking your car’s seat design and measuring space to guarantee compatibility. Some vehicles simply don’t have the room or anchoring options needed for a load leg.
